Web26 apr. 2024 · Overview Percutaneous nephrolithotomy (per-kyoo-TAYN-ee-uhs NEF-roe-lih-THOT-uh-me) is a procedure used to remove kidney stones from the body when they can't pass on their own. "Percutaneous" means through the skin. The procedure creates a passageway from the skin on the back to the kidney. WebVariant Lithotomy. The Lloyd Davies position is a variant of the lithotomy position. The key differences being that the degree of hip flexion is less than with the lithotomy position and the patient is also placed in approximately 30 degrees Trendelenburg. It is used for gynecological and colorectal pelvic surgery. Lithotomy Position ...
